Amendment 80 #
Motion for a resolution
Recital I
I. whereas the Battlegroup Concept has helped develop multinational defence cooperation and interoperability, as well as transformation for rapid deployment and force modernisation; whereas battlegroups have never been used;

Amendment 139 #
Motion for a resolution
Recital P
P. whereas, in line with Article 41 of the TEU, the administrative and operating expenditure for the RDC should be charged to the Union budget except for expenditure that is covered by the European Peace Facility, notwithstanding the possibility for participating Member States to make free- of-chargevoluntary contributions to the RDC;

Amendment 141 #
Motion for a resolution
Recital P a (new)
Pa. whereas more than 50 % of the budget of the European Peace Facility for the period 2021-2027 has already been used;

Amendment 161 #
Motion for a resolution
Paragraph 1 a (new)
1a. Considers it necessary to update the Strategic Compass in order to incorporate lessons learned from Russia’s war of aggression against Ukraine launched days before its adoption and to study the advisability of adapting the Rapid Deployment Capability to the new geopolitical context;
